Transaction

40d9c989d1e2aa7fd05ca09f8a68ce2b097a3d2fbea2cb030990137a1ebcf701
257,620 confirmations
Timestamp
1616964342
Block676,749
Fee34,949 sats
Fee rate62.3 sats/vB
view on mempool.space

Inputs & Outputs